In today’s rapidly evolving world, understanding the ethical implications of life sciences and technological advancements is no longer a niche concern; it’s a fundamental aspect of informed citizenship. The Udemy course, “Bioethics – the ethics of everyday life,” dives headfirst into this complex and crucial field, offering a comprehensive exploration that extends far beyond the confines of traditional medical ethics.

From its very inception, bioethics, as coined by Fritz Jahr in 1927, has been about the ethics of life itself. This course masterfully unpacks this broad definition, demonstrating how bioethical considerations permeate our daily news cycles, from discussions of equality and fairness to the critical issues of environmental stewardship and the treatment of other species. It’s a fascinating intersection of policy, law, ethics, science, technology, politics, and philosophy, challenging learners to think critically and engage with multifaceted issues.
